What I Used

* Barbara Daly Concealer in Warm to camouflage undereye circles
* Rimmel Professional Eyebrow Pencil in Hazel to fill in eyebrows
* MAC Tea Time pigment on crease
* MAC Royal Flush pigment on lid
* NARS All About Eve eyeshadow duo under brow bone
* MAC Fluidline in Blacktrack to line
* Rimmel Glam’ Eyes Mascara in Extreme Black on upper and lower lashes
